Bills announce 3-year extension with St. John Fisher University
‘St. John Fisher will continue to host the Bills training camp from 2026 through 2028. The Bills say large reason why they chose to continue their partnership is because of the university’s ability to host the entire team and its staff for several weeks.’

Bills announce extension to keep training camp at St. John Fisher, with Wegmans as sponsor
‘The Bills have held their training camp at the Pittsford campus annually since 2000, except for 2020 and 2021 when they stayed in Orchard Park due to the COVID-19 pandemic.’

Analysis: Bills three-tight end personnel grouping has been the league's best
‘The Bills have run 29 plays out of 13 personnel, which is 6.62% of their offensive snaps. That rate ranks No. 9 in the league, so the Bills are maximizing the times they have the grouping on the field.’
